One of the most notable advances of this model is the implementation of the Predictive Efficient Drivean innovative system that uses real-time data and previous driving patterns to automatically adjust the behavior of the powertrain.

This approach not only optimizes performance, but also significantly improves the vehicle’s electric range, by allowing the Toyota C-HR to make real-time decisions on when to operate in electric or hybrid mode.

In the words of the brand, This technology allows for “effortless driving”as the vehicle adapts to route and traffic conditions without driver intervention.

Predictive Efficient Drive also incorporates a feature called Geofencing, which aims to further optimize the vehicle’s efficiency depending on the environment.

By connecting the cloud navigation system with real-time traffic information, The C-HR is able to adjust its operation to prioritize the use of electric mode in low-emission areas or in dense urban areas, where restrictions are more severe.

In addition, geofencing technology makes it possible to anticipate road conditions and activate the hybrid system when it is most convenient, thus maximizing fuel savings and reducing emissions.

Toyota C-HR 2024: an evolution in design and technology

In terms of design, The 2024 Toyota C-HR follows the modern, sharp lines of the Japanese manufacturer’s Beyond Zero (BZ) rangea visual language that seeks to underline the transition towards electrification.

The front and rear of the crossover feature a more dynamic and aerodynamic look, with LED lighting clusters that give it a more technological and futuristic appearance.

These updates not only improve aesthetics but also aerodynamic efficiency, contributing to the vehicle’s overall performance.

The interior has also received a thorough renovation. The 2024 Toyota C-HR’s cabin stands out for its focus on technology and driver comfort.

The infotainment system has been improved to offer a more fluid and connected experienceintegrating a state-of-the-art touchscreen with wireless connectivity to mobile devices and compatibility with intelligent voice assistants.

Also, the Toyota Safety Sense system has been optimized to offer even more advanced driving assistance features, such as pedestrian detection, adaptive cruise control and forward collision warning.

Intelligence applied to energy efficiency

One of the aspects that really differentiate the Toyota C-HR Plug-in Hybrid 220 from other plug-in hybrid models is its ability to learn from the driver.

Using data from previous trips, the Predictive Efficient Drive system can identify braking and acceleration patterns on common routes and automatically optimize energy efficiency in those areas.

For example, The system increases the force of regenerative braking in areas where the driver usually decelerates.which helps to recover more energy and extend electrical autonomy.

This feature, combined with a new battery thermal management system, ensures that the vehicle maintains optimal performance even under demanding driving conditions.

Toyota has implemented a battery heating system which reduces charging time when the vehicle is plugged in and an active cooling system to prevent overheating during long journeys or in high temperatures.

This approach not only extends battery life, but also allows the vehicle to maintain consistent performance and greater range.

Improved power and autonomy

The Toyota C-HR Plug-in Hybrid 220 combines the best of both worlds: a 2.0-liter gasoline engine with a power of 152 horsepower and a 163-horsepower electric motor on the front axleresulting in a combined output of 220 hp.

That setup allows it to move with agility both in the city and on the highway, offering a smooth and efficient ride. However, where it really stands out is in its ability to operate in fully electric mode, with a range of up to 106 kilometres thanks to its 13.6 kWh battery.

When the battery is depleted, the system automatically switches to hybrid mode, combining the electric and combustion engines to maximize efficiency.

This change is imperceptible to the driver, reinforcing the idea of ​​“effortless driving” that Toyota has wanted to implement in this model.
